Output 89544664c925053defde4c0c25f411843c300095ef335497b657a0e3004f75fe:1

value
893361
script pubkey
OP_0 OP_PUSHBYTES_20 8b902ee33b9e5521fa867e0932cc9d479b291307
address
bc1q3wgzacemne2jr75x0cyn9nyag7djjyc88q7xgw
transaction
89544664c925053defde4c0c25f411843c300095ef335497b657a0e3004f75fe